US SEC files new motion in Ripple lawsuit and says case is still under appeal
U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) has filed a new motion opposing non-party Justin W. Keener's emergency request in the Ripple case to submit "decisive evidence" favorable to the defendant. The SEC argues that since the case has been moved to the second circuit court, the district court has lost jurisdiction and therefore cannot accept Keener's request. In addition, the SEC points out that Keener did not comply with proper legal procedures as he did not file a formal motion to intervene.
